Chapter 870

    Chapter 870:


    William’s frown deepened. “What’s been going on with you these past few days? Why are you avoiding me?”


    The evening breeze carried a chill, rustling the bushes outside the institute.


    Ste looked at William’s stubborn expression, her heart skipping a beat. The sunset framed William in a golden glow, deepening the mystery in his eyes, making it hard for Ste to read him.


    Two days had passed.


    William had thought their time in Swaynia, filled with subtle sparks, would bring them closer.


    But since returning, Ste had grown distant, a new barrier rising between them. William’s voice, lower than usual, carried a mix of doubt and vulnerability that hit Ste hard.


    His gaze seemed to pierce into Ste’s soul, pulling out her doubts andying them bare between them.


    Ste’s first instinct was to avoid the question, her fingers tightening around the strap of her bag as a faint chill settled into her hands.


    Uncertainty clouded her mind. Should she ask William directly if he had gone on a date yesterday, or if there was someone from his past he still held close? The words hovered on her lips, but she forced them back down.


    What authority did she even have to question him? And if she dared ask, what would she do if his reply confirmed her fears?


    Anxieties piled on top of each other, leaving her gaze fixed on the floor. In a carefully measured tone, she said, “You’re reading too much into this. I’m not avoiding you. I’ve just been buried in finishing the project.”


    “So you’re buried in work, but not enough to spare a moment for dinner? Too busy to even acknowledge me in the hallways?” William’s tone carried disbelief. He stepped closer, his shadow stretching across her.

    When Ste continued to look away, impatience edged into his voice. “Ste, look at me when you speak.”


    Ste’s usual confidence faltered. Why did his presence feel so overwhelming? Reluctantly, she lifted her eyes, and in his dark, ocean-like gaze, she saw her own pale reflection staring back at her.


    William kept his eyes locked on Ste, his brow furrowed as if trying to unravel the reason behind her distant mood. “Did someone at the institute bother you again? Is Nina making trouble?”

    Once, that kind of protection would have soothed her heart, but now it pricked like a thorn, echoing Nina’s taunts in her mind.


    Could it be that his sudden attentiveness was nothing more than guilt for meeting someone else yesterday?


    Ste turned away from his piercing gaze, her voice tight. “It’s not that. I’ve just been busy with work. If there’s nothing else, I need to leave.” Ste tried to move past William.
